🚀 Course Title: Classical Music Class: Inside Ravel's Musical Mind
Join us on an enchanting voyage into the heart of French Impressionism with our online course, dedicated to the masterful works of composer Maurice Ravel. This course is meticulously crafted to provide a deep study of Ravel's compositions and his main influences, highlighting his unique fusion of modernity and classicism.
Course Headline: A Deep Study of Ravel's Compositions and Main Influences on His Music Style
🌍 What You’ll Explore:
-
Ravel's Aesthetics: Understand the profound impact of French art and artists like Degas, Renoir, and Cézanne on Ravel's music.
-
Musical Analysis: Delve into the intricacies of Ravel's works with an in-depth examination of texture, melody, form, harmony, and orchestration.
🎵 Highlighted Masterpieces:
-
✨ Mother Goose Suite: Unravel the charm of "The Conversation of Beauty and the Beast" and other enchanting pieces from this collection.
-
🔥 Boléro: Trace the evolution of this iconic piece, famously commissioned by the legendary ballet dancer Ida Rubinstein.
